Dodge City – Howard E. Schlereth, 87, died June 12, 2009, at his home in Dodge City.

He was born December 14, 1921, at Offerle, the son of Anna Mary and John Michael Knopp Schlereth. He was a farmer.

He belonged to the Cathedral of our Lady of Guadalupe, V.F.W., and American Legion, all of Dodge City, and he was in the United States Air Force.

He married Maudene Corey, then later, he married Maureen Smith at Beaver, Oklahoma, on April 29, 1981. She survives.

Other survivors include: a son, Greg Schlereth, Jetmore; three daughters, Sharon Guthrie, Sandy Hendrickson, Deanna Unruh, Jetmore, a step son Danny Mahieu, Fowler; three step daughters, Janet Enlow, Margie Delziet, Dodge city, Brenda Richman, Meade; one sister, Margaret Wolf, Dodge City; six grandchildren, fourteen step grandchildren; three great grandchildren and six step great grandchildren.

He was preceded in death by a three brothers, Henry, Raymond, and George; a sister, Agnes Gladden.
